Amour Patrick Tignyemb  is a Cameroonian footballer who currently plays for Bloemfontein Celtic in the South African Premier Soccer League.

Tignyemb formerly played for Cotonsport Garoua and Tonnerre Yaoundé.

He was part of the Cameroonian 2004 African Nations Cup team, who finished top of their group in the first round of competition, before losing in the quarter finals to Nigeria. Tignyemb also competed at the 2008 Summer Olympics. He earned his first senior cap for his homeland on 09 February 2005 against Senegal national football team
